Snowy Christmas

Who gives a damn if it's sunny right now in your state? By hosting the party, you can still have a Winter Wonderland Christmas. Use white fairy lights, fake snow to cover your workspace, and snowflakes hanging from the ceiling. To stay on trend, choose decor in all shades of white and silver. You might even order an ice sculpture to be delivered on the day of the company party if you're feeling particularly generous. Or you could create a snowman out of Styrofoam for less money.

Winter chic or an outfit with a Frozen theme could be appropriate for the dress code. Workflow advises drinking a chilly vodka cocktail or a hot cup of mulled wine from the open bar. Warm foods like baked lasagna, apple pie, shepherd's pie, and panna cotta are preferred.

You may construct an indoor ski slope or organize a pleasant skating session at the neighborhood ice rink for entertainment. Or if you have the budget, you can take the whole office to Banff or anywhere up the mountains where you can ski, snowboard, and party in actual snow!

Mask party

If you want a no-brainer theme that almost everyone says yes to, then go for a masquerade ball; it is a popular favorite. After all, the COVID-19 season has already gotten us all used to don masks. Request that everyone dresses to the nines for the event. Theater masks and red and gold accents should be used in the room's décor. All of the night's arrivals must be greeted by a red carpet and stage lighting. For a comprehensive meal, serve starters, a main dish, dessert, and champagne.

For the music, engage a jazz band, and for the after party, a DJ. Provide prizes for the King and Queen of the Night. A station for producing masks might also be present in the location. The party's icebreaker may be a fun round of "Who Am I?" There would be a sheet of paper with your name on it on your forehead. For you to know who you are, you must go around and engage in conversation with the other visitors. It might also be turned into a game for couples in which you are given a partner from a love team and must search the room for them.



The International Christmas Party

Whether or not the office staff enjoys traveling, it is always fun to experience Christmas in a different nation. Nearly every nation pauses and celebrates the season differently around Christmas time. Make the celebration a potluck and invite the visitors to bring food from their native countries if your workplace is international or from their hometowns.

Ask attendees to dress in national attire or in something that makes them think of their native country or their family's roots. Make a playlist from other countries as the soundtrack for the night.

Organize a fun trivia contest about the numerous Christmas customs and rituals observed around the world.
